Plans for a brand new cycle path in Pontarddulais have been permitted regardless of issues about its impact on a territorial canine and a van parked there since 1990.
The brand new shared-use path will begin from Pentre Highway, on the northern fringe of Rhydgoch Cemetery, and run in a north-east route to Birch Rock Highway and from there to Bolgoed Highway, which hyperlinks the city to Pontlliw.
It’ll go alongside the boundary of a former brickworks at one level, throughout a big water predominant at one other, and likewise observe the route of an present rear lane utilized by Pentre Highway properties. Some timber should be minimize down.
The planning utility by Swansea Council led to 5 objections from individuals who raised a variety of issues, amongst them the trail’s influence on the rear lane.
One objector stated their canine was territorial and can be disturbed by cyclists, inflicting “extreme barking”. One other stated residents parked automobiles on the lane, together with a van that’s been there for 35 years.
Privateness and safety fears had been additionally expressed, together with doubt {that a} new shared-use path was wanted given there was a brand new one at close by Coed Bach Park, and concern that off-road motorcyclists would possibly use it. There was additionally a letter of assist which stated the trail would enhance entry for schoolchildren and supply a path to outlets. It added: “The present overgrown land shall be improved with the creation of the trail, enhancing the native space’s look.”
Council planning officers have permitted the applying whereas imposing circumstances equivalent to a requirement for extra timber to be planted than shall be minimize down and the submission of a contaminated land remediation technique.
A call report by officers stated they acknowledged a brand new shared-use path could result in privateness, safety and high quality of life worries for some folks however added: “Primarily based on the data obtainable, it isn’t anticipated on steadiness that any perceived or unreasonable further hurt past the present scenario can be brought on by the proposed improvement.”
The advantages of the mission, they stated, had been encouraging folks to take fewer journeys by automotive and enhancing their well being and well-being.
Pentre Highway is served by one other shared-use path to the south, which hyperlinks Pontarddulais with Gowerton. Pontarddulais councillor Kevin Griffiths stated this path and the one by means of Coed Bach Park had been well-used by cyclists and walkers.
Referring to the most recent planning resolution, he stated: “You’re all the time going to have individuals who approve and individuals who disapprove,” he stated.
